The Origins and Development of Paper Bags

The use of paper bags is not a recent development. The bulk of Indian stores, primarily in tier 2 and tier 3 cities and beyond, still carry paper bags, which are a rather ancient industry in India. But the majority of these bags are envelope-shaped and handleless. The Indian market, which is well-known for its environmentally friendly jute bags, is relatively new to the flat-bottomed bags with handles.

Ad

In 1852, Francis Wolle created the first machine to generate paper bags in large quantities. Wolle and his brother founded the Union Paper Bag Company and patented the device. In 1853, James Baldwin was granted the first patent for the machine used to create paper bags with a square bottom. In England, he worked as a papermaker in Birmingham and Kings Norton. Baldwin subsequently started using the picture of a bag with a flat bottom as his company’s emblem.

ad

In 1871, inventor Margaret E. Knight came up with a machine that could produce flat-bottomed paper bags, which gave the notion a boost. Compared to the earlier envelope-style design, these bags were found to be able to hold more. In 1883, Charles Stilwell eventually received a patent for a machine that could produce paper bags with pleated sides and a square bottom. These bags became the superior choice since they are simpler to fold and store. Another name for the Stilwell sacks was S.O.S., or Self-Opening Sack.

In fact, Walter Deubener introduced the most recent version of paper bags with handles in 1912. Deubener, a grocer from Saint Paul, Minnesota, reinforced paper bags with cords and added carrying handles. Named for Walter Deubener, the “Deubener Shopping Bags” gained popularity quickly because they could hold almost 75 pounds at the time. By 1915, it was selling over a million bags annually.

Because of their durability and convenience of use, department stores and other establishments adopted paper bags with handles as the norm after this. However, when plastic bags were introduced in the 1970s, they overtook paper bags. Due to their affordability and portability, these bags became the go-to option for both customers and retailers. Paper bags and other environmentally friendly alternatives are becoming more and more popular as a result of the discovery that plastic bags are actually quite bad for the environment.

Paper Bag Types

Paper bags fall into a variety of categories. But when it comes to these bags, there are two main types that are typically found:

White paper bags: These chemically treated paper bags are also known as white kraft paper bags. In order to whiten and purify the natural kraft pulp, these bags are bleached and treated with additional chemicals.
Brown paper bags: Unbleached kraft pulp is used to make brown paper bags, often known as brown kraft paper bags.

The market potential and opportunities of the paper bag industry

The global paper bag market is projected to reach $7.3 billion between 2022 and 2030, growing at a consistent 4.1% CAGR. In 2022, the paper bag market was worth $5.2 billion worldwide. In 2022E, the combined market share or value share of the top 5 paper bag manufacturers is projected to be 11%.

In 2018, the Indian paper bag market was valued at $5.95 billion. The nation currently exports 400 crore rupees worth of paper goods annually.

There isn’t a true competitor for paper. Once thought to be an alternative to paper bags, plastic bags have become less popular over time. Additionally, the construction of retail centers and consumer stores has raised demand for paper bags even more. For new and aspiring business owners, the paper bag industry is therefore a booming potential.

Calculate the Business Costs of Making Paper Bags

Paper bag manufacturing will require less capital because it is often a small-scale enterprise. The cost of labor, land, and machinery will be the primary areas of investment. Variable investments will come from marketing, transportation, and maintenance.

One fully automated paper bag-making machine costs between 5 and 8 lakh Indian rupees. The machine’s output capacity determines the price. One completely automated machine can make 15,000 pieces each hour. Your costs can be significantly decreased by doing your homework and making the right plans for where to spend your money and which suppliers to use.

Register your business.

A local municipal government will need you to register your firm and acquire a trade license.

– Here, you have the option to register as a sole proprietor or as an LLP or company.
– After that, you will need to finish your SSI or UDYOG AADHAR MSME registration. It is intended for – companies operating as small-scale industries.
– After that, you must choose to register your business for GST to make it GST-compliant.
– Finally, you must obtain the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S) accreditation for your business.

Profits Anticipated from the Production of Paper Bags

In a minute, the paper bag-making machine can produce sixty bags. A profit of 10 paise per bag is possible. Therefore, for every minute you spend manufacturing bags, you can make Rs 6 in profit. You might anticipate making close to Rs 2800 per day if manufacturing and marketing go well. This comes to a monthly total of Rs 70000. However, these earnings differ based on a number of other aspects of your company.
